Analysis

The most recent figure for mobile outbound gross enrolment ratio, tertiary students studying in in WB: Africa Eastern and Southern is 0.7883 UIS estimate, measured in 2023. That is the highest value across all 13 years on record.

That represents a change of up 6.6% on the previous year and up 18.1% over ten years.

Over the whole period, mobile outbound gross enrolment ratio, tertiary students studying in in WB: Africa Eastern and Southern peaked at 0.7883 UIS estimate in 2023 and was at its lowest, 0.3625 UIS estimate, in 2011.

That places WB: Africa Eastern and Southern 124th out of 221 groups with data for 2023, putting it in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 13 years of available data.
